AN ACT PROHIBITING THE USE OF METHOPRENE AND RESMETHRIN UNDER CERTAIN CIRCUMSTANCES.

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Assembly convened:

That the general statutes be amended to prohibit the use of methoprene and resmethrin where such use would result in such chemical being introduced to a waterway that drains into Long Island Sound.

Statement of Purpose:

To prevent methoprene and resmethrin from being introduced into the waters of Long Island Sound.
